FourthRev, a London, UK-based startup developing a SAAS connecting corporates with university programs, announced the completion of a £2.3M ($3.2M) capital investment round.

The money was raised from investors led by Reach Capital along with existing shareholders Emerge Education and Dunce Capital and angel investors including US education executive Craig Pines and Charlie Songhurst, former Head of Corporate Strategy at Microsoft.

FourthRev, founded in 2019 by Jack Hylands and Omar de Silva, developed a software solution that is connecting leading companies and universities to enable the delivery of up-to-date, industry relevant programs, ranging from micro-credentials through to degree courses.

The company says that it works with tech companies including AWS, GitHub and Tableau, and top universities providing access to programs with qualifications and employment in the digital economy. Currently, FourthRev courses are available via 11 higher educational providers worldwide including University of Coventry and FutureLearn, RMIT, University of Canberra and University of California, Irvine.

FourthRev previously raised some $500k from Dunce Capital and Emerge Education.
